Understanding AI Tools for Coding
AI Tools for Coding encompass a wide range of applications, including code generation, intelligent code completion, bug detection, and code refactoring. These tools leverage machine learning algorithms to analyze patterns in existing codebases and provide valuable insights to developers.
Code Generation
AI-powered code generation tools can automatically write code based on predefined parameters and requirements. This significantly reduces the time and effort required to produce functional code, allowing developers to focus on higher-level problem-solving tasks.
Intelligent Code Completion
By analyzing the context and syntax of the code being written, AI tools can offer intelligent code completion suggestions, enhancing the developer's productivity and minimizing errors. This feature is particularly useful for speeding up the coding process and ensuring code consistency.
Bug Detection
AI tools are adept at identifying potential bugs and vulnerabilities within code, enabling developers to address issues proactively during the development phase. This proactive approach to bug detection helps prevent costly errors and security breaches in production environments.
Code Refactoring
AI-powered code refactoring tools analyze existing codebases to suggest improvements in terms of readability, performance, and maintainability. By automating the refactoring process, these tools assist developers in optimizing their code without compromising functionality.
Advantages of AI Tools for Coding
The integration of AI tools into the coding process offers several benefits that contribute to a more streamlined and efficient development workflow.
Enhanced Productivity
AI tools for coding enable developers to write, review, and optimize code at a faster pace, resulting in increased productivity and faster time-to-market for software applications.
Improved Code Quality
By providing automated suggestions and corrections, AI tools help maintain code quality standards, reducing the likelihood of logic errors and coding inconsistencies.
Smarter Decision-Making
AI tools analyze large volumes of code and provide valuable insights that can inform better development decisions, leading to more robust and scalable software solutions.
Learning and Adaptation
AI tools continuously learn from the code they process, improving their accuracy and relevance over time. This adaptive capability ensures that developers have access to the most up-to-date and effective coding assistance.
